Guillain-Barre syndrome refers to the condition where the immune system of the body starts attacking the peripheral nerves.

Usually, this condition is triggered by an acute bacterial or viral infection, or a vaccine. In an interview with HT Lifestyle, Dr Rajesh B Iyer, consultant - neurology and epileptology, Manipal Hospital, Millers Road said, “Guillain-Barre syndrome occurs due to an immune reaction in the body leading to damage of the peripheral nerves.

Typically, the condition occurs after an upper respiratory tract or a gastrointestinal infection and rarely after vaccinations and sometimes after surgery.”
